heading to jeff dearborn, michigan. good morning. your next. jeff, you're us, sir. what a stingray and a what? a stingray. listening devices and what dirt bikes is. we can take those up. a stingray listening device. so i don't know what a dirt fox is. stingray is essentially a fake cell phone tower. it's also as an imc catcher. and this is a device that was developed on the private market in the 1980s and 1990s. and has become favored tool of law enforcement in the 21st century. the use of the stingray has grown up in the gray of the law for quite some time. it's unclear whether it's legal use a stingray or not. it can be used in certain jurisdictions can't and others. but it's cropped up in recent in ice investigations in detroit in drug investigations in baltimore and even in the monitoring of black lives matter protests and activism in chicago. this is an important story that i didn't quite have room to fit into the book, but it tracks along with the history of wiretapping. the wiretap grows up in american law enforcement in the same kinds of legal gray areas. qu

so i've come to dearborn, michigan to talk to an engineer at ford who helps design seats. >> biggestack isn't supported at all on this. >> reporter: but to alleviate back pain she says you need to start on the floor. many cars now have movable pedals so drivers of any height can get their heels down. then adjust the seat so your knees aren't pressed against it. >> you want to have a couple of fingers between here ideally to say you don't have compression of the calf, back onto the seat. >> reporter: maybe the most important, your distance to the steering wheel. i heard there was one rule if you can rest your arms here, just as a distance measure, then you're probably right. >> yeah, i would say it's almost more of your palm not the break of your wrist but as you slide your hands down you want this to do that so you're probably estimate right. >> reporter: she says many don't realize their steering wheel moves up and down and in and out. it has a range. as for the back there's no one correct angle but the lumbar support for the "c" curve of the spine is something she recommends adjust
